We’re sorry to hear about your impression of Miracle Math and would like to clarify a few misunderstandings for the benefit of other parents reading this.

Our recommendation for students to take both E-Math and A-Math is never about insisting — it’s based on years of experience showing that students who struggle with E-Math often face similar challenges in A-Math, as both subjects are closely linked. Many students achieve stronger and more lasting improvement when both are supported together.

During A-Math lessons, our teachers focus purely on A-Math concepts. Therefore, students enrolling only in A-Math are expected to already have a solid E-Math foundation (typically around a B3 grade or better). If a student’s E-Math foundation is weak, we usually recommend focusing on E-Math first or taking both concurrently to strengthen understanding and confidence.

You mentioned that your child failed both E-Math and A-Math. In such cases, it’s far more beneficial to strengthen E-Math first, as it forms the foundation for success in both subjects and has a greater impact on O-Level results.

We do have students who take A-Math with our centre and E-Math elsewhere, or vice versa, so it’s not true that we only accept strong students. In fact, many of our students have improved significantly — some from F9 to A1 — through consistent effort and the right guidance based on the recommendations we provide.

Regarding make-up lessons, all our classes are video-recorded so that students who miss a session can review the full lesson at their own pace. This ensures that no learning time is lost, even if they cannot attend physically.

We always strive to give honest and professional advice — even when it may not be what some wish to hear. Allowing a student to take A-Math without first addressing E-Math gaps could lead to unnecessary stress and limited improvement, which we would never want for any student.
